OSI Geospatial signs U.S. military contracts valued at US$1.5 million
OTTAWA, CANADA--(Marketwire - Sept. 11, 2008) - OSI Geospatial Inc. (TSX:OSI) announced today its U.S. Systems Operations has signed two contracts with the U.S. Military valued at approximately US$1.5 million in total. Under the terms of the contracts, the company will further develop and enhance its advanced training technology to meet future U.S. Military requirements.
"We continue to make solid progress in the development of our training technology for military applications," said Ken Kirkpatrick, president and CEO of OSI Geospatial."I am confident that we can build on this work with the U.S. military to create future business opportunities in both the U.S. and Canada."
